
We announce the peaceful passing of Vera Marie Baker of
Pleasantville at home on September 26, 2025.
She was born
in Pleasantville to Gladys & Calder Richards on February 8,
1933.
In her younger years she worked at Creasers
Factory in LaHave, she then started looking after children at home,
she was always a part of the Pleasantville Baptist Church.
She is survived by her husband of 67 years Lee Baker, and many
nieces and nephews.
She was predeceased by
her parents Gladys & Calder
Richards; daughter Carol; brothers Clifton
(Lillian), Ralph (Margaret), Elmer and twin Eldred; sister Norma
(Gerald) and niece Bonnie Blinn-Richards.
